Fault Codes:Kobelco SK135SR-2 P0336

What is Kobelco SK135SR-2 Fault Code P0336?

Fault Code P0336 on the Kobelco SK135SR-2 indicates a Crankshaft Position Sensor "A" Circuit Range/Performance Problem. This diagnostic trouble code (DTC) means the Engine Control Module (ECM) has detected an irregular or inconsistent signal from the crankshaft position sensor (CKP sensor), which monitors the rotational speed and exact position of the crankshaft.

The crankshaft position sensor is critical for engine timing operations on this excavator. It provides real-time data to the ECM to control fuel injection timing, ignition timing (on certain engine types), and overall engine synchronization. When the sensor signal falls outside the expected range or shows erratic performance patterns, the ECM triggers P0336. On used Kobelco SK135SR-2 machines, this can severely impact engine performance, fuel efficiency, and starting reliability, making immediate diagnosis essential.

Common Symptoms

  • Rough or erratic engine idle with noticeable vibrations or inconsistent RPM
  • Hard starting conditions or extended cranking time before the engine fires
  • Engine stalling during operation, particularly under load or at idle
  • Loss of power or hesitation during acceleration and hydraulic work cycles
  • Check Engine Light (CEL) illuminated on the instrument cluster

Potential Causes

The most common technical causes for P0336 on used SK135SR-2 excavators include:

  • Worn or damaged crankshaft position sensor due to heat exposure, vibration, or age-related degradation
  • Corroded or loose electrical connectors at the sensor harness connection point
  • Damaged sensor wiring harness caused by rubbing against engine components, heat shields, or mounting brackets (common wear point near the bell housing area)
  • Contaminated sensor face from oil leaks, metal debris, or dirt buildup blocking the magnetic pickup
  • Damaged reluctor ring (tone wheel) on the crankshaft with missing or damaged teeth
  • Weak battery or charging system issues causing voltage fluctuations that affect sensor signal quality
  • ECM software issues or internal ECM faults (less common)

How to Troubleshoot and Fix Code P0336

Step 1: Visual Inspection Begin by locating the crankshaft position sensor (typically mounted near the flywheel/flexplate area or front crankshaft pulley). Inspect the sensor body for physical damage, oil contamination, or cracks. Check the wiring harness for signs of chafing, burns, or damage—especially at rub points near engine mounts and heat sources common in used machines.

Step 2: Connector and Wiring Check Disconnect the CKP sensor connector and thoroughly inspect for corrosion, bent pins, or moisture intrusion. Clean contacts with electrical contact cleaner if needed. Using a digital multimeter, check sensor resistance (typically 200-1000 ohms, consult service manual for exact specifications). Test wiring continuity from sensor connector back to the ECM connector.

Step 3: Sensor Gap and Reluctor Ring Inspection Verify the air gap between the sensor tip and the reluctor ring meets manufacturer specifications (usually 0.5-1.5mm). Inspect the reluctor ring for missing teeth, cracks, or metal debris accumulation. On used excavators, metal shavings from engine wear can accumulate here.

Step 4: Voltage Signal Testing With the sensor connected, use an oscilloscope or advanced multimeter to monitor the AC voltage signal while cranking the engine. The signal should show consistent waveform peaks. Erratic or absent signals indicate sensor or reluctor ring failure.

Step 5: Replace or Repair If testing confirms sensor failure, replace the crankshaft position sensor with an OEM or high-quality aftermarket unit. If wiring damage is found, repair harness sections and ensure proper routing away from heat and friction points. Clear codes using Kobelco diagnostic software or compatible scan tool and test operation.
